Quote:
Originally Posted by alhar View Post
Hi some posts state the boxes are being sold as FTA boxes,I have tried to use my box with an aerial but it was futile,so these boxes are not free to air boxes ,you have to use them with cable boxes which you have to pay a fee for
The box has a DVB C tuner and not a DVB T tuner

which is why they dont work with a '' Ariel''
